About DSM DTU
Delhi School of Management (DSM) was established in 2009 with Delhi College of Engineering (DCE) acquiring a University status. The DCE was later renamed officially as Delhi Technological University (DTU) through a legislature passed by the Delhi State Assembly. DSM extends the seven-decade long legacy of DCE by incubating and developing techno-managers. DSM offers MBA in Business Analytics, MBA in Family Business and Entrepreneurship and MBA in Innovative Entrepreneurship and Venture Development.
Location: DSM, Delhi Technological University is situated at Shahbad Daulatpur, Main Bawana Road, Delhi. The nearest metro station is Samaypur Badali, which is 3.7 km away from the institution, which takes 10 minutes to reach by auto or taxi. The nearest bus stop is Delhi Engineering College, which is 1 minute away from the institution.

Delhi School of Management (DSM) offers MBA in Business Analytics, MBA in Family Business and Entrepreneurship and MBA in Innovative Entrepreneurship and Venture Development. DSM also offers Ph.D in management. The detailed admission process of the MBA and Ph.D is given below:
Admission Process for MBA:
Candidates are required to fill an online application form on this website to participate in the centralized admission of CMAC.
The candidates will be shortlisted on the basis of the performance in CAT Exam. They have to participate in the Centralised Counselling for admission held by CMAC.
Shortlisted candidates will be required to appear for a Group Discussion and Personal Interview.
Admission process for Ph.D:
Applicants need to apply online and register.
Eligible candidates will have to appear for the written test.
Shortlisted candidates will have to appear for interview.

Delhi School of Management (DSM) has the facility of the hostel, computer centre, auditorium, sports, gym and bank facilities: The details about these facilities are given below.
- Hostel: DSM provides hostel facilities for boys and girls. The hostels cater to the needs of outside Delhi students as well as the Delhi students staying far off from the college campus.
Computer Centre: DSM has a well-equipped centralized computer centre to cater to the needs of students and faculty in the university. It is housed in a magnificent state-of-the-art building having specialised laboratories to provide a variety of platforms and computing environment for UG, PG and research students.
Auditorium: Dr B. R. Ambedkar Auditorium has equipped, fully air-conditioned, state of the art audio-visual infrastructure for webcasting. It is having a seating capacity of six hundred and fifty.
Sports: DSM is having 400m running track, ground for Football, Hockey, Cricket, two courts for Volley Ball, two courts for Basketball, three courts for Tennis and five courts for Badminton, Three Kabaddi courts, Indoor Games facilities are also provided i.e. Table Tennis rooms, Chess rooms, Carom rooms and Gyms are also available in each hostel of the DTU campus.
Gymnasium: DSM has an ultra-modern gymnasium with high-tech equipment. The gymnasium has been refurbished recently and new equipment like digital electronic treadmills have been added to the impressive setup.
Health Centre: DSM has a full-fledged 20-bed hospital block. The college invites specialized medical practitioners for ENT, eye, dental care, nutrition experts once a week. Services of two medical practitioners are available to the students throughout day and evening.
Backing Facilities: The State Bank of India (SBI) has a branch within the college campus to cater to the banking requirement of the students. All the banking transactions are carried out within the branch itself.
Alumni Affair: Alumni office deals with illustrious alumni, and make sure their frequent presence in the organization. This office is acted as a bridge between senior alumni and current or passed out students. The facility provides career guidance and counselling to find out a suitable job in their respective domains. Another role is to convince alumni to contribute funds for the betterment of their alma mater.
Centres:
Innovation and Incubation Centre (IIC): The centre provides Start-up grants to students and faculty members in the areas of management, innovation, and entrepreneurship. It also promotes management and innovation-driven business ventures that lead to technical innovation. The centre offers incubation facilities to help students transform their ideas into commercially viable products.
Entrepreneurship Development Centre (EDC): The centre is developed with an objective to create an entrepreneurial culture in science and technology and to foster techno entrepreneurship and knowledge enterprise development. The centre guides the budding students to pursue entrepreneurship as their career.
Centre for Organizational Development: The aim of this centre is to provide research, education, consultancy and extension services which enable organizations to transform its human resources effectively for consistent improvement and enable efficient change management. The COD endeavours to provide research-based insights and solution.

- The candidate must hold a Bachelor‘s Degree, with at least 50% marks or equivalent CGPA (45% in case of the candidates belonging to Scheduled Caste (SC), Scheduled Tribe (ST) and Differently Abled (DA)
- The percentage of marks obtained by the candidate in the bachelor‘s degree will be calculated based on the practice followed by the university/ institution from where the candidate has obtained the degree. In case the candidate is awarded grades/CGPA instead of marks, the conversion of grades/CGPA to percentage of marks will be based on the procedure certified by the university/ institution from where the candidate has obtained the bachelor’s degree. In case the university/ institution does not have any scheme for converting CGPA into equivalent marks, the equivalence will be established by dividing the candidate‘s CGPA by the maximum possible CGPA and multiplying the result with 100.
- Candidates appearing for the final year of bachelor‘s degree or equivalent qualification and those who have completed degree requirements and are awaiting results can also apply.
- Candidates need to submit their graduation scores latest by 31 st October, 2019. If the students fail to submit the score or get below 50% in graduation, they will be ineligible for the program.
- Candidates,applying for admission must provide information about score in an entrance test. DSB (http://dsb.edu.in/) accepts scores of, CAT, GMAT, XAT, MAT , CMAT and other equivalent examinations. They should satisfy the minimum score requirement of the institute .
- The institution will confirm the eligibility of a candidate by verifying the mark sheets,degree certificates and the entrance test score.

The center possesses a number of servers and over 200 Dell Intel core i5 computer systems. In addition the centre has more than 15 servers hosting different applications such as websites & portals, SPSS, Mathematica, MatLab, DNS, LDAP, proxy, Email services, Network Monitoring System (NMS) etc. and 4 SUN CAD workstations meant for use by UG/PG/ Ph.D. students for their projects and research work. The centre is fully networked through high-end intelligent Avaya & CISCO switches, and possesses round the clock 1 Gbps NKN leased line , ISDN and a 50 Mbps leased line in a different pipe for the LAN wired & Wi-Fi connectivity for the academic, administrative and hostel blocks of the campus, with internet facilities on all the nodes. It also has the latest versions of compilers, scientific, technical and engineering software, training kits etc. for the students of different branches of engineering.
